Question Erreur dans la récupération (clé): erreur interne -3 dans R_decompress1


J'ai le problème suivant:

  1. J'ai une version de développement de mon paquet chargé en session R

  2. J'ai édité le fichier source.

  3. Je le détache et fais:

    system("R CMD check realizedvolatility")
    system("R CMD build realizedvolatility")
    system("R CMD install realizedvolatility_0.1.tar.gz")
    library(realizedvolatility)
    
  4. Jusqu'à présent, tout fonctionne. Maintenant, si j'essaie de faire apparaître un fichier d'aide, par exemple ?realizedvolatility , l'erreur

    Error in fetch(key) : internal error -3 in R_decompress1
    

se produit.

Le remède est de redémarrer entièrement la session R, puis tout fonctionne. Est-il possible de le faire fonctionner en une seule session? J'ai essayé de me détacher de l'espace de nommage, d'installer avec différentes options, rien n'a fonctionné.

J'utilise Mac OS X Lion et R 2.14.1


15
2018-04-29 14:50


origine


Réponses:


J'ai posé la même question dans R-help et un core R a répondu "c'est par conception" ce qui signifie que vous ne pouvez rien y faire sauf le redémarrage de R: https://stat.ethz.ch/pipermail/r-help/2011-July/283916.html (bien que je ne comprenne toujours pas pourquoi cette conception ne peut pas rafraîchir la base de données cache ...)


19
2018-04-29 17:56